Planned Airway Management, Key to Successful Peri - Operative Outcome: A Case Report of Accidental Ballistic Maxillofacial Trauma Posted in Emergency for Primary Repair
Dr. Maninder Singh Raizada [3] | Dr Latesh Saphiya | Dr Vipan Garg
Abstract: Airway management of patients with maxillofacial trauma is complex and crucial because it can dictate a patient's survival as it involves the airway and breathing is compromise. We present a case report of 32 year old male of a burst ballistic injury with maxillofacial trauma managed in emergency OT.
